Main Campfire - Evening

Isabel and Cameron had managed to get the campfire going in the main area. Luckily the weather was a lot clearer than yesterday and things had remained dry. There were several containers with snacks and beverages standing along the side and there was an abundance of marshmallows for people to get through a whole weekend with.

And now it was just a matter of waiting for people to show up and recapture the cabin spirit one last time before fall and winter truly set in.
